About this calculator

This calculator finds return on investment, ROI = (net gain − cost of investment) / cost of investment × 100, expressing the profit or loss from an investment as a percentage of what was originally put in. It's a simple, universal profitability metric that doesn't account for the time value of money or holding period — unlike annualized return or IRR — which is why it's best used to compare investments of similar duration.

Business owners, marketers evaluating campaign spend, real estate investors, and everyday investors use ROI to judge whether a purchase, project or investment paid off relative to its cost. Enter the initial cost and the final/net gain to get the ROI percentage.
